SPEC 3120 Psychosocial Aspects of Deafness 3-0-3 An introduction to the study of deafness and how it impacts on both the psychological and the social development of the individual. The focus of this class is toward a general understanding of deafness as a psychosocial variable that is influential in shaping the life experiences and functioning of individuals who are deaf and/or hard of hearing. Incorporates further study of the significance of deafness by examining interactions between and among those who are and those who are not deaf.
